Welcome aboard! You're joining the Farepath pricing experiment at Brightloom Transit Labs. Short version: we A/B test ticket prices on the Harwick–Delmere line, bucketing riders by purchase channel. Dashboards update nightly; don't trust intraday numbers. Experiment configs live in the pricing-flags repo and need sign-off before deploy. The flags vault opens with the recovery passphrase shown below.

vault phrase of fahog-yajof = istael-zorwyn

Subject: DR drill — test-data factory library

New folks,

Welcome to the Harkway team. Next Tuesday we run our quarterly disaster-recovery drill. Scope: restoring the Fabrikett test-data factory library from cold backup and regenerating fixture sets. You'll each rebuild one fixture domain; instructions are in the drill doc. Restoring the backup archive requires the team recovery passphrase at the restore prompt. For drill purposes, the passphrase is provided below.

unlock words, bagag-kajef: zormir-jorath-tammir-oliius-briix-norys

☐ Verify drift-compensation seed for the Verdanta GH-7 greenhouse controller before sealing the ceremony record. The humidity and CO₂ sensors on the Willowmere test bay have shown gradual drift since the last calibration, so confirm the offset table was regenerated within the past 24 hours and countersigned by the Harrowfield custodian. Once both witnesses attest that the calibration hash matches the printed worksheet, record the recovery passphrase exactly as read aloud below.

unlock words, hahip-baduf: holwyn-istath-julvan

Environment Variables — Shelfhound Catalog Invalidation

This page covers the variables the invalidation worker reads at boot. CATALOG_INVALIDATE_BATCH controls how many product keys are purged per cycle; keep it at 500 unless the Dorrance cluster is backlogged. CATALOG_TTL_SECONDS must match the edge cache config or you will see stale prices after promotions. On-call should edit worker.env only during a quiet window. The purge API credential goes on the line directly after the TTL setting, so append it there.

env line for fafof-fahag: LEDGER_TOKEN5=f8790